RHSA-2005-504: telnet Vulnerability Scan
Vulnerability Scan Summary Check for the version of the telnet packages
Detailed Explanation for this Vulnerability Test
Updated telnet packages that fix an information disclosure issue are now
available.
This update has been rated as having moderate security impact by the Red
Hat Security Response Team.
The telnet package provides a command line telnet client.
Gael Delalleau discovered an information disclosure issue in the way the
telnet client handles messages from a server. A possible hacker could construct
a malicious telnet server that collects information from the environment of
any victim who connects to it.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ures
project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CVE-2005-0488 to this issue.
Users of telnet should upgrade to this updated package, which contains a
backported patch to correct this issue.
